Improving Retention through Intensive Practice in College Survival Skills.
McIntire, Roger W.; And Others
NASPA Journal, v29 n4 p299-306 Sum 1992
Examined effectiveness of General Education 100 (GNED 100), behaviorally oriented course addressing nonacademic/academic factors affecting student retention. Compared to performance predicted by university's admissions formula, performance of 407 GNED 100 students exceeded predicted norms by as much as 1 grade point. Differences related positively to performance in GN ED 100, being greatest for students performing well in course. (Author/NB)
